CPS Test for Evaluating Click Speed and Tap Performance
A CPS test is a simple and engaging way to measure how many mouse clicks or screen taps a person can complete within a specific duration. CPS refers to clicks per second, which is worked out by dividing the overall clicks by the selected test duration. The final score offers a useful measure of clicking speed, finger coordination and reaction consistency. Many people engage with this activity for entertainment, skill improvement, challenges and gaming preparation. Whether the test is set for short or longer durations, the goal stays consistent: click or tap as quickly and accurately as possible while maintaining a steady rhythm.
Understanding a CPS Test
A cps test captures all valid clicks inside a specific testing zone during a chosen duration. Once the timer finishes, the system calculates the average clicks per second. For example, if 50 clicks are made in ten seconds, the result is five clicks per second. The calculation is easy to understand, but the activity can provide valuable insight about hand speed, concentration and control. The test typically begins on the first click, which allows the participant to start without losing valuable time. A counter often shows the number of completed clicks and the time left. After the session concludes, the final score appears immediately. People can then try again to compare results and identify whether their speed is improving.
Click Per Second Scores Explained
A CPS score shows the average clicks achieved per second. Results depend on the testing duration, device quality, clicking technique, hand position and individual experience. A short-duration tests can give higher scores because the participant can maintain peak speed briefly. Longer sessions usually require better endurance and rhythm. A beginner may first concentrate on accurate and controlled clicks rather than trying to achieve a high score immediately. As coordination gets better, speed improves on its own. Consistent results across several attempts can be more meaningful than one unusually high score. Repeated testing helps users understand their normal performance range instead of depending on one attempt.
Working of a Click Speed Test
A clicking speed test relies on a timer and built-in click counter. The participant chooses a time limit and keeps the cursor inside the active area. The first click starts the timer, after which all valid clicks are recorded until time runs out. The final result is worked out by dividing clicks by time. Accuracy is essential because clicks outside the test zone may be ignored. Participants should keep the pointer stable and avoid unnecessary mouse movement. A comfortable grip can also reduce tension in the fingers. Steady presses tend to work best than uneven bursts that lead to tiredness. Different test durations serve different goals. A one-second session measures explosive clicking ability, while a five-second session provides a balance between speed and control. Extended durations highlight click speed test endurance and control. Trying multiple durations provide better insight of overall clicking performance.
Common Clicking Techniques
The standard clicking method uses one finger to tap the mouse button repeatedly. This technique is easy to learn and ideal for general use. Maintaining a loose hand and consistent rhythm can help produce consistent scores without causing discomfort. Jitter clicking involves creating small vibrations in the forearm area to generate rapid button presses. It may boost CPS, but it can also cause discomfort when used incorrectly. Participants should pause if discomfort arises, numbness or unusual strain. Butterfly clicking involves alternating two fingers on the same mouse button. The alternating movement may boost clicking speed because alternating fingers reduce delay. Performance relies on device compatibility and the participant’s control. Some devices may register alternating presses differently, so results can differ. Drag clicking uses friction across the button in a way that creates repeated contact. This method needs compatible hardware and good technique. It is not supported equally by every mouse, and too much pressure can harm the mouse. For general practice, basic or butterfly methods are more practical.
Touchscreen Tap Per Second Testing
A tap per second test measures how many screen taps a person can complete during a chosen duration. It works like CPS testing, but the interaction takes place on a screen. The participant repeatedly taps the active area until the timer reaches zero. Touchscreen results may differ from mouse results because tapping uses different motions and screen sensitivity. Device size, sensitivity and positioning can all influence speed. Keeping the device still during testing may increase consistency. Some participants prefer one finger, while others switch fingers for better performance. A regular tapping is more effective than aggressive tapping. Pressing too hard does not increase the score and may lead to discomfort. Soft tapping helps movement while avoiding discomfort.

Improving Your CPS Performance
A proper posture helps improve performance. The forearm should rest comfortably, while the wrist should not be strained. Excessive tension can reduce speed and increase strain. Adjusting the seating and desk height may improve comfort. Participants should practise in short intervals and pause regularly. Repeating tests too often can cause strain. Rest helps recovery and improves endurance. Light stretching exercises may also improve flexibility. Choosing the right technique is equally important. Standard clicking is ideal for beginners, while alternating fingers may help increase speed. Users should not use painful methods. A comfortable method with stability is more valuable than a brief high score followed by pain.
Factors Influencing Test Results
Mouse quality, button resistance and device response can affect results. A stiff button may require more force, while a responsive button detects clicks easily. Touchscreen tests can be impacted by device speed, background processes and the condition of the screen surface. Test duration also affects performance outcome. Very short sessions focus on rapid clicking, whereas longer sessions evaluate consistency. Distractions, tiredness and hand temperature may affect performance as well. For fair comparisons, users should maintain consistent conditions and do multiple trials.
